🚫A clean break isn’t always the best way to heal

Healing is messy, and cutting ties completely may not always lead to closure.

Sometimes, gradual detachment allows for more reflection and acceptance.

🧘‍♀️You don’t always have to ‘find yourself’ after a breakup.

Growth doesn’t require reinventing who you are.

You were whole before the relationship, and you can still be whole after—no need to pressure yourself into a “new you.”

💭It’s okay to mourn the future you imagined

Letting go of the life you envisioned with someone is part of the grieving process.

Acknowledging this loss helps you move forward with more clarity.

🔍 Breakups can be more about self-reflection than blame.

Instead of looking for who’s at fault, focus on what the experience taught you.

Breakups can offer valuable insights about your needs, boundaries, and desires.

Breakups aren’t one-size-fits-all—give yourself permission to heal in your own way. ❤️

Confidence is often seen as the missing key when y Confidence is often seen as the missing key when you’re around someone you find attractive. 

But here’s the thing—confidence isn’t about pretending to be perfect, it’s about accepting who you truly are. 💯

1️⃣ **Learn to accept yourself fully**: 

When you embrace your quirks, flaws, and strengths, you automatically start projecting confidence. 

Remember, no one can make you feel less than unless you allow it.

2️⃣ **Rejection is what they think, not who you are**: Rejection isn’t a reflection of your worth. 

It’s simply a matter of personal preference. Don’t take it personally—focus on what you bring to the table and let others’ opinions pass by like a breeze.

3️⃣ **Be present**: 

When you’re fully in the moment, the mind doesn’t have time to race with insecurities. 

Stay grounded, focus on the conversation, and enjoy the experience rather than worrying about the outcome.

Confidence is all about staying true to who you are. 

So own your narrative and watch how your energy shifts. ✨

Honeymoon Phase
The beginning of a relationship feels like a dream—everything is new and effortless.

You’re wrapped up in affection, constant attention, and deep conversations that feel like they could last forever.

But remember, while this phase is magical, it’s a chance to build something deeper.

⛈️
When Things Get Tough
Eventually, real life sets in.

Small differences turn into misunderstandings, and daily challenges begin to impact your relationship.

This is when friction can arise, causing doubt or frustration.

You might start to question if the relationship is worth it and feel like your love is fading away

But during this time, learn about each other and work on real, long-term intimacy.

❤️
The Real Love Moment
True love isn’t about never having issues—it’s about working through them together.

This phase is where you experience unconditional support and genuine partnership.

You’ve seen each other at your best and worst, and you still choose to stay.

Love now is steady, deep, and more meaningful than ever before.

You’re not just in love; you’re in a mature, connected relationship. 💪🏻

Every stage has its purpose and importance.

The highs remind us of why we fell in love, and the lows teach us how to stay in love.

Honest, open, and vulnerable conversations are the key to lasting love.

Keep talking, keep listening, and most importantly—keep loving. 💬💖
